Flow Meter Differential Pressure Type

Differential pressure flowmeter is an instrument that calculates the flow rate based on the differential pressure generated by the interaction between the flow detection device installed in the pipeline and the fluid, known fluid conditions, and the geometric dimensions of the detection device and the pipeline.
The differential pressure flowmeter consists of a primary device (detection component) and a secondary device (differential pressure converter and flow display instrument). Differential pressure flow meters are usually classified in the form of detection components, such as orifice flow meters, Venturi flow meters, uniform velocity tube flow meters, Pitot tube principle Pitot bar flow meters, etc.
The secondary device includes various mechanical, electronic, and electromechanical integrated differential pressure gauges, differential pressure transmitters, and flow display instruments. It has developed into a large class of instruments with a high degree of standardization (serialization, generalization, and standardization) and a wide variety of specifications. It can measure both flow parameters and other parameters (such as pressure, level, density, etc.).
The detection components of differential pressure flow meters can be divided into several categories based on their working principles: throttling device, hydraulic resistance type, centrifugal type, dynamic pressure head type, dynamic pressure head gain type, and jet type.
The test pieces can be divided into two categories based on their degree of standardization: standard and non-standard.
The so-called standard testing parts can determine their flow values and estimate measurement errors as long as they are designed, manufactured, installed, and used according to standard documents, without the need for actual flow calibration.
Non standard test pieces are those with poor maturity and have not yet been included in international standards. Differential pressure flowmeter is the most widely used type of flowmeter, with its usage ranking first among various flow instruments. Due to the emergence of various new flow meters, their usage percentage has gradually decreased, but they are still the most important type of flow meter at present.
